One of the best museums you can go to and definitely a place you have to visit if you are a tourist in the city. There is no entry fee, tonnes of exhibits and lots of opportunities to take great photos. There is usually an exhibition on that you will pay more to see but the museum is so big that you can be there all day without having to worry about paying to see more.

Amazing museum, very informative and educational. Lots of things to discover, history of Scotland, science, wildlife just to name a few. Absolutely fascinating.There's a free guide tour at 11am. Our guide, Andrew was incredible, his knowledge of the museum and it's history was astonishing. One of the best museums I've have ever been to.

Well..what can I say...refreshingly brilliant!! LESS REALLY IS MORE!! By not packing stuff in to the rafters, like they do in London museums, it allows time to really see and absorb the items. Far far better engagement, especially for youngsters. Great mix of everything, things, like tech, really stimulating. Even had art and cultural iconic mix of ceramic, furniture, glass...just inspiring. To whomever coordinated and selected you did a great job!!

Great section about the history of Scotland, very enjoyable! I think if they made a 'trail' to follow for this, it would improve the experience, as it wasn't clear where to start each section. Other than that, the sections on the Jacobite Rebellions were full of rich detail, with great pieces to look at! And it's all for free!? Please do donate as it is such a great place.

This was an incredible Museum! I did not have enough time to fully explore it but enjoyed my short visit. It is free to enter although they do ask for a donation. It has lots of exhibits including the history of Scotland, a fashion exhibition and much more. It is very impressive to walk through and I imagine it is a kids dream. They have a huge room with all sorts of interactive activities which looked like a lot of fun!
